4 Financial Markets to Look For When Investing – Lesson #7

When beginning to analyze the market for where you want to focus your investments, it’s important to understand the different financial markets.

Diversification is key to a strong portfolio and it begins with the Top-Down formula which has Markets as the main first step.

4 Financial Markets to Understand, Dissect and Invest In

1. Sector Funds – most stocks will be found in sector funds that can range from technology to schools to healthcare and more.

2. Real Estate Funds – or better known as REIT’s focus specifically on all things in real estate. A huge benefit/bonus of owning in this sector is that they normally pay a higher than normal dividend yield.

3. Precious Metal Fund – the Gold and Silver market, considered to be one of the most volatile mainly go up and down with the inflation % and information.

4. Index Funds – the safer way to invest. This is used mainly by beginner investors since they seem, like me, to be told – ‘You Can’t beat the market!’ – We’ll see about that.
